package clangutils
import (
"errors"
"unsafe"
"github.com/goplus/llgo/c"
"github.com/goplus/llgo/c/clang"
)
type Config struct {
File string
Temp bool
Args []string
IsCpp bool
Index *clang.Index
}
func CreateTranslationUnit(config *Config) (*clang.Index, *clang.TranslationUnit, error) {
// default use the c/c++ standard of clang; c:gnu17 c++:gnu++17
// https://clang.llvm.org/docs/CommandGuide/clang.html
defaultArgs := []string{"-x", "c"}
if config.IsCpp {
defaultArgs = []string{"-x", "c++"}
}
allArgs := append(defaultArgs, config.Args...)
cArgs := make([]*c.Char, len(allArgs))
for i, arg := range allArgs {
cArgs[i] = c.AllocaCStr(arg)
}
var index *clang.Index
if config.Index != nil {
index = config.Index
} else {
index = clang.CreateIndex(0, 0)
}
var unit *clang.TranslationUnit
if config.Temp {
content := c.AllocaCStr(config.File)
tempFile := &clang.UnsavedFile{
Filename: c.Str("temp.h"),
Contents: content,
Length: c.Ulong(c.Strlen(content)),
}
unit = index.ParseTranslationUnit(
tempFile.Filename,
unsafe.SliceData(cArgs), c.Int(len(cArgs)),
tempFile, 1,
clang.DetailedPreprocessingRecord,
)
} else {
cFile := c.AllocaCStr(config.File)
unit = index.ParseTranslationUnit(
cFile,
unsafe.SliceData(cArgs), c.Int(len(cArgs)),
nil, 0,
clang.DetailedPreprocessingRecord,
)
}
if unit == nil {
return nil, nil, errors.New("failed to parse translation unit")
}
return index, unit, nil
}
// Traverse up the semantic parents
func BuildScopingParts(cursor clang.Cursor) []string {
var parts []string
for cursor.IsNull() != 1 && cursor.Kind != clang.CursorTranslationUnit {
name := cursor.String()
qualified := c.GoString(name.CStr())
parts = append([]string{qualified}, parts...)
cursor = cursor.SemanticParent()
name.Dispose()
}
return parts
}
